The Significance of Sugar Cane in Global Agriculture



Sugar cane serves as a vital crop in worldwide farming, underpinning economic situations and food systems in many exotic regions. This functional plant is largely cultivated for its high sucrose material, which is refined into sugar, a staple ingredient in countless foodstuff. Past sweetening, sugar cane is likewise essential for producing biofuels, specifically ethanol, adding to power sustainability.The economic value of sugar cane includes work, providing source of incomes for numerous farmers and workers in processing facilities. In a number of countries, sugar cane growing and handling stand for significant sections of farming GDP, affecting trade balances and regional development.Additionally, sugar cane's versatility to different environments improves its value as a crop, making sure regular supply in global markets. Its byproducts, including molasses and bagasse, better diversify its energy, making it an essential component in food, power, and industry. Overall, sugar cane stays a keystone of farming productivity worldwide.


Cultivation Processes: From Planting to Harvest



Cultivating sugar cane involves a collection of distinct processes that assure optimal growth and return. The farming starts with land preparation, where the soil is tilled to protect optimum oygenation and water drainage. Following this, seed cane, which includes mature stalks, is selected and reduced right into segments (sugar cane products). These sectors are after that planted in furrows, making sure correct spacing to permit for sunlight and nutrient access.Once planted, irrigation systems are employed to preserve adequate moisture levels, as sugar cane flourishes in moist problems. Weeding and insect management are important during the growing duration to reduce competitors for sources. Nutrient application, including fertilizers, sustains robust growth. As the plants grow, keeping track of for diseases and bugs continues.Harvesting normally occurs 10 to 24 months post-planting, depending upon the selection. The walking sticks are cut close to the ground, guaranteeing marginal waste, and are quickly transported for refining to protect sugar quality

Major Making Countries



Sugar cane is expanded in different regions worldwide, specific countries dominate production due to desirable environments and agricultural practices - sugar cane products. Brazil leads the global market, representing roughly one-third of complete production, thanks to its considerable plantations and advanced farming techniques. India complies with as a significant producer, taking advantage of both favorable climate condition and a large residential market. China and Thailand also rate among the top manufacturers, with well-established frameworks sustaining their sugar industries. Other remarkable contributors consist of the USA, Mexico, and Australia, each leveraging their unique agricultural systems to improve outcome. These countries play a vital duty in the sugar cane supply chain, influencing global rates and accessibility


Environment and Dirt Demands



Ideal this content environment and dirt conditions are critical for effective sugar cane production. Sugar cane thrives in exotic and subtropical areas, needing warm temperatures in between 20 ° C and 30 ° C (68 ° F to 86 ° F) These plants need bountiful sunlight and rainfall, preferably between 1,500 to 2,500 millimeters annually, to ensure peak growth. The dirt must be well-drained, fertile, and abundant in natural matter, with a pH degree preferably between 5.5 and 8.5. Sandy loam or clay loam soils are especially for sugar cane growing, offering required nutrients and water drainage. Geographical distribution is greatly influenced by these variables, with major production areas located in Brazil, India, and China, where ecological problems straighten with the plant's needs for development and return.

Climate Change Impacts





Exactly how do environment change effects affect the feasibility of sugar cane farming? Rising temperatures and unpredictable weather condition patterns notably challenge sugar cane growers. Enhanced warmth can lead to decreased yields, as the plants battle to grow in severe conditions. Furthermore, modified rainfall patterns cause either droughts or excessive flooding, both damaging to crop health. Parasites and conditions are likely to multiply in warmer environments, additionally harmful production. Furthermore, dirt destruction and salinization because of increasing water level can diminish arable land. These weather modifications compel cultivators to adapt their methods, commonly needing financial investment in brand-new modern technologies and resistant plant ranges. Eventually, the sustainability of sugar cane farming rests on addressing these environment challenges successfully.

Market Cost Volatility



Market rate volatility presents considerable obstacles for sugar cane farmers, impacting their economic security and preparation. Changes in market costs, driven by factors such as global supply and need, weather problems, and government policies, create unpredictability for manufacturers. This changability makes it challenging for growers to forecast earnings and handle operating budget successfully. In addition, when rates go down all of a sudden, numerous farmers may struggle to cover production costs, bring about prospective economic distress. To reduce these risks, some farmers transform to agreements or hedging methods, yet these options might not come to all. Market price volatility stays a relentless issue, influencing the total sustainability and earnings of sugar cane farming.

Market Trends Affecting Sugar Cane Rates



The dynamics of sugar cane costs are affected by a variety of market patterns that mirror more comprehensive economic problems and customer habits. Global need for sugar and sugar-related products plays a vital role, with enhancing passion in organic and sustainably sourced items driving rates higher. Furthermore, fluctuations in oil prices influence the cost of production and transport, more affecting market rates. Climate patterns are one more significant variable; adverse conditions can cause minimized yields and boosted rates. Trade plans, tolls, and worldwide contracts additionally shape the market landscape, influencing supply chains and schedule. Currency exchange rates can make complex global profession, influencing rates for both merchants and importers. Changes in customer preferences towards healthier options might alter need patterns, creating a ripple result on sugar cane pricing. sugar cane products. Comprehending these interconnected trends is essential for stakeholders in the sugar sector.

What Are the Main Pests and Diseases Affecting Sugar Cane?



The primary parasites influencing sugar cane consist of the sugarcane borer and aphids. Diseases such as red rot and smut substantially influence return. Farmers have to apply integrated insect management approaches to alleviate these dangers effectively.


Just How Is Sugar Cane Processed Into Different Products?



Sugar cane handling includes crushing the stalks to draw out juice, complied with by information, dissipation, and formation. This procedure yields raw sugar, molasses, and ethanol, each offering distinct purposes in various markets, from food to energy.
